This commit is contained in:
Lemon
2023-03-14 16:53:06 +08:00
parent 31727d150f
commit 57a95ee7ee

View File

@@ -251,6 +251,31 @@ public class MemberController extends BaseController {
return response;
}
/**
* 用户修改车牌号
* http://localhost:8080/uniapp/member/memberUpdatePlateNumber
*
* @return
*/
@PostMapping("/memberUpdatePlateNumber")
public RestApiResponse<?> memberUpdatePlateNumber(HttpServletRequest request, @RequestBody BindingCarNoDTO dto){
logger.info("用户修改车牌号 params:{}", JSONObject.toJSONString(dto));
RestApiResponse<?> response = null;
try {
String memberId = getMemberIdByAuthorization(request);
MemberPlateNumberRelation relation = MemberPlateNumberRelation.builder()
.memberId(memberId)
.licensePlateNumber(dto.getCarNo())
.build();
int i = memberPlateNumberRelationService.updatePlateNumber(relation);
response = new RestApiResponse<>(i);
} catch (Exception e) {
logger.error("用户修改车牌号 error", e);
response = new RestApiResponse<>(ReturnCodeEnum.CODE_USER_UNBIND_CARNO_ERROR);
}
logger.info("用户修改车牌号 result:{}", response);
return response;
}
/**
* 用户解除绑定